SpaceX, founded in 2002 by Elon Musk, is a leading aerospace manufacturer and space transportation company headquartered in Hawthorne, California. The company has developed the Falcon 9 and Falcon Heavy rockets, as well as the Dragon spacecraft, which delivers cargo to the International Space Statio...

Overview

SpaceX is hiring an HVAC Technician for the Starlink Facilities team to maintain critical infrastructure for satellite operations. This role requires expertise in HVAC systems and a commitment to safety and quality standards.

Job Description

Who you are

You have experience in maintaining and repairing HVAC systems, ensuring that all equipment operates efficiently and effectively. You understand the importance of preventative maintenance and are familiar with various HVAC support equipment, including air handlers, chilled water systems, and cooling towers. You are detail-oriented and committed to following safety regulations and quality policies, including those set by OSHA and the EPA. You thrive in collaborative environments, working closely with engineering teams and managers to maintain systems in peak operating condition. You are eager to contribute to a mission-driven company like SpaceX, where your work directly supports the development of advanced satellite technology.

Desirable

Experience with HVAC systems in a technical or industrial setting is a plus. Familiarity with safety regulations and quality standards in the HVAC field will help you excel in this role. A proactive approach to problem-solving and a willingness to learn new technologies will also be beneficial as you grow in your career.

What you'll do

As an HVAC Technician on the Starlink Facilities team, you will be responsible for maintaining and repairing HVAC support equipment critical to the operation of SpaceX's satellite constellation. You will perform regular inspections and preventative maintenance on building and facility HVAC systems to ensure they are functioning optimally. Collaborating with engineering and management teams, you will address any issues that arise and implement solutions to maintain peak operating conditions. You will follow all regulations and appropriate SpaceX procedures, ensuring compliance with safety policies and quality standards. Your role will be vital in supporting the infrastructure that enables SpaceX to continue its mission of making space travel accessible and sustainable.
